Rethinking the Coordinate-Subordinate Dichotomy : : Interpersonal Grammar and the Analysis of Adverbial Clauses in English / / Jean-Christophe Verstraete.
This study argues that the domain traditionally covered by 'coordination' and 'subordination' in English can be subdivided into four distinct construction types. The constructions are defined on the basis of differences in their 'interpersonal' structure, i.e. the gramm...
